这是我的函数,我想创建一个函数来计算数字的排名,但它总是在排名中返回1。如何修复它,并在启动前添加“ N / A”。
Function Ranking(Score As Double) As Integer
Dim count As Integer
Range("C6").Value = "N/A"
Ranking = 1
For count = 1 To num_of_students
If student_records(count, 3) > Score Then
Ranking = Ranking + 1
Else
Exit For
End If
Next
Range("C6").Value = Ranking
End Function